What is the principle of Archimedes screw?
The Archimedes screw is a form of positive-displacement pump. A positive-displacement pump traps fluid from a source and then forces the fluid to move to a discharge location. The Archimedes screw is made up of a hollow cylinder and a spiral part (the spiral can be inside, but here you’ll put it outside the cylinder).
What is Archimedes Principle explain with example?
Archimedes’ Principle : When a solid body is partially are completely immersed in a fluid, the fluid exerts an upward force on the body, whose magnitude is equal to the weight of the displaced fluid. Example, a ship floats on water due to the Archimedes principle.

How does Archimedes screw Work ks2?
The Archimedes screw consists of a screw (a helical surface surrounding a central cylindrical shaft) inside a hollow pipe. As the shaft turns, the bottom end scoops up a volume of water. This water is then pushed up the tube by the rotating helicoid until it pours out from the top of the tube.

How does Archimedes screw generate electricity?
The Archimedes screw generator consists of a rotor in the shape of an Archimedean screw which rotates in a semicircular trough. Water flows into the screw and its weight presses down onto the blades of the turbine, which in turn forces the turbine to turn. Water flows freely off the end of the screw into the river.
What was the purpose of the Archimedes screw?
An Archimedes screw is a device which is designed to lift liquids from one level to another. Put in simpler terms, it’s a pump. This device is one of the earliest mechanical pumps invented by humans, and it continues to be use in some regions of the world today. Variations on the basic design can also be utilized for solids such as ashes and grain.
What is an Archimedes’ screw used for?
An Archimedes’ screw, also known by the name the Archimedean screw or screw pump, is a machine used for transferring water from a low-lying body of water into irrigation ditches. Water is pumped by turning a screw-shaped surface inside a pipe. The Archimedes screw consists of a screw (a helical surface surrounding a central cylindrical shaft) inside a hollow pipe.
